Brief Description: More trimming on bottom rudder enclosure.
Today we had to trim the enclosure some more to streamline it the tailcone. I cut lengthwise to allow the enclosure to move up. To move up some more I also had to increase the depth of the rudder arm slots. After some sanding, I refitted it to the rudder and measured where to drill the hole in the foreward end to pull the wires to the light. I then drilled a 1/2" hole for a 3/8" snap bushing.
